Fall Grazing Conference
A grazing conference focusing on low-stress livestock handling!
The University of Kentucky Martin-Gatton College of Agriculture, Food and Environment, with the Kentucky Forage and Grassland Council, the Kentucky Agricultural Development Fund and the Kentucky Beef Network will offer the Kentucky Fall Grazing Conference Oct. 31 at the Hardin County Extension office in Elizabethtown and Nov. 1 at the Fayette County Extension office in Lexington.
Participants should pre-register. Advance registration is $45 per person; day-of registration is $60 per person and student registration is $15.
Events begin at each location with registration at 7:30 a.m. local time and run until 3:30 p.m.
